Skip to content

Commit

Permalink
Merge pull request #34118 from owncloud/mitigate-preview-expiry
Browse files Browse the repository at this point in the history
Skip preview expiry when owner cannot be determined
  • Loading branch information
DeepDiver1975 authored Jan 21, 2019
2 parents 3d1e54d + 3921212 commit cef6e25
Showing 1 changed file with 10 additions and 2 deletions.
12 changes: 10 additions & 2 deletions lib/private/Preview.php
Original file line number Diff line number Diff line change
Expand Up @@ -1238,7 +1238,11 @@ public static function prepare_delete(array $args, $prefix = '') {
$path = Files\Filesystem::normalizePath($args['path']);
$user = isset($args['user']) ? $args['user'] : \OC_User::getUser();
if ($user === false) {
$user = Filesystem::getOwner($path);
try {
$user = Filesystem::getOwner($path);
} catch (NotFoundException $e) {
return;
}
}

$userFolder = \OC::$server->getUserFolder($user);
Expand Down Expand Up @@ -1308,7 +1312,11 @@ public static function post_delete($args, $prefix = '') {
if (!isset(self::$deleteFileMapper[$path])) {
$user = isset($args['user']) ? $args['user'] : \OC_User::getUser();
if ($user === false) {
$user = Filesystem::getOwner($path);
try {
$user = Filesystem::getOwner($path);
} catch (NotFoundException $e) {
return;
}
}

$userFolder = \OC::$server->getUserFolder($user);
Expand Down

0 comments on commit cef6e25

Please sign in to comment.